The Modelica project heatpump testbench was initially based on AixLib 0.7.3. This shows how a tight integration of Python and Modelica is possible, e.g. preparing a simulation by swapping heatpump base data and simulation via Python.
With AixLib 0.9.1, there are currently two issues preventing a seamless update:
- AixLib 0.9.1 is not fully compatible with OpenModelica. AixLib.DataBase.ThermalMachines.Chiller.ChillerBaseDataDefinition causes an error in OpenModelica, while it works in Dymola. There is an easy workaround, but currently the authors seem unwilling to include it, since it makes the code somewhat less elegant. See issue "FastHVAC heat pump does not run in OpenModelica" 864 in https://github.com/RWTH-EBC/AixLib (I do not want to link directly, because that reference would be shown there). I tried to be as polite as I can possibly be, but I do not agree with their decision. Fortunately, we do not need the chiller function, so we can work around the issue.
- Replacing the heat pump data programmatically via Python is an essential part of the testbench. Due to changes to the heatpump model in 0.9.1, this data selection is now contained in a redeclare statement. This syntax of the Modelica standard is not fully supported by OpenModelica (Dymola handles it just fine), so there is no command to replace this information. See this for more details: https://stackoverflow.com/questions/62168453. An update with that feature is being worked on, but we can only wait patiently for it to happen.
